What companies run services between Gelsenkirchen, Germany and Hamburg, Germany?

Deutsche Bahn Intercity (DB IC) operates a train from Gelsenkirchen Hbf to Hamburg Hbf every 3 hours. Tickets cost €65–280 and the journey takes 3h 5m. Alternatively, GrandBus operates a bus from Essen Hbf to Hamburg once daily, and the journey takes 4h 14m. East West Eurolines also services this route once daily.
